US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"complementary material"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to refer to any additional information or materials that are provided to supplement or support the main content of a sentence, paragraph, or document. Example: "In addition to the textbook, the teacher also provided the students with complementary material such as online videos, practice exercises, and study guides."

Common error

Avoid using "complimentary material" when you mean "complementary material". "Complimentary" means given free of charge or expressing a compliment, while "complementary" means enhancing or completing something else. Double-check your spelling to ensure you're conveying the correct meaning.

Linguistic Context

The phrase "complementary material" functions as a noun phrase, where the adjective "complementary" modifies the noun "material". It describes items or information that enhance or complete something else. Ludwig AI confirms this usage across diverse contexts.

FAQs

How can "complementary material" enhance a learning experience?

Providing "complementary material", such as videos, interactive exercises, or detailed case studies, alongside core content can cater to different learning styles and deepen understanding.

What's the difference between "complementary material" and "supplemental material"?

While both terms refer to additional resources, "complementary material" often implies a more integrated and essential role in enhancing the primary content, whereas "supplemental material" is more of a bonus or extra.

In what contexts is "complementary material" typically used?

"Complementary material" is commonly used in academic, scientific, and business settings to refer to additional information that supports or enhances the main content. This includes supplementary readings, datasets, or multimedia resources.

What are some examples of "complementary material" in a scientific study?

Examples of "complementary material" in a scientific study include detailed experimental protocols, raw datasets, additional figures or tables, and supplementary analyses that support the findings presented in the main article.
